A common 30 yard roll off dumpster is a popular choice for major home improvement projects. These dumpsters offer ample room to remove waste efficiently.

To ensure you get the perfect dumpster fit, it's crucial to understand its specifications. A 30 yard dumpster typically measures 40 feet long x 8 feet wide x 6 feet tall.

Remember that these are just typical dimensions, and differences can occur based on the manufacturer.

Always confirm the exact dimensions with your dumpster service to avoid any difficulties during your project.

Assessing the Measurements and Expenses of a 12 Yard Roll Off Dumpster

Sizing up your waste removal needs? A 12 yard roll off dumpster is a popular choice for many projects, offering a good balance between capacity and affordability. These versatile dumpsters can comfortably handle the debris from home renovations, landscaping projects, or even small commercial cleanups. To determine whether a 12 yard dumpster is right for you, examine the volume of your waste and compare it to the container's dimensions. These dumpsters typically measure around 20 by 8 by 4 feet. Remember that exceeding the weight limit can incur additional charges, so be mindful of what you're getting rid of. The cost of renting a 12 yard dumpster varies based on location, rental period, and waste type. It's best to get estimates from different providers to find the most reasonable option.

Securing a Quote for Your 10 Yard Roll Off Dumpster: Factors to Consider

When you require a 10-yard roll off dumpster, getting accurate quotes is essential. To ensure you obtain the best price, consider these vital factors:

  • Spot of your project: Dumpster delivery costs can vary based on distance from the company's yard.
  • Waste type and volume: Different materials may have varying disposal fees.
  • Lease duration: Longer rentals often come with reductions.
  • Additional services like unloading: These can impact the overall quote.

Don't hesitate to ask for multiple quotes from several dumpster rental companies to contrast your choices.

Renting a 10 Yard Dumpster Estimate: General Prices in Your Location

Need to dispose of some debris? A 10 yard dumpster might be just the solution. But before you rent one, it's wise to know what you can expect to pay. The average cost of a 10 yard dumpster differs depending on your place and elements like the duration you need it for.

On average, you can expect to pay somewhere between $150-$250 for a 10 yard dumpster lease.

  • However, this is just a general guideline. Factors like the quantity of garbage you have, specific items, and the waste disposal service's terms can all affect the final rate.
  • It's always best to reach out to several dumpster providers in your neighborhood to compare prices. This way, you can find the best deal for your needs.

Sizing Up Your Needs: 30 Yard Dumpster Dimensions

When it comes to clearing out debris, a Thirty cubic yard dumpster is a popular choice for larger projects. These units offer ample capacity to handle demolition waste, household cleanouts, or even garden cleanup.

To make sure a 30-yard dumpster is the right match for your needs, it's crucial to understand its dimensions. These units typically measure approximately 40 ft long by 8 ft wide. The top can vary, but generally ranges from six to seven feet.
